- What is your typical process for working with a new customer?
First thing, I like to touch base with a client. Thumbtack Requests are great for making initial contact, but I find that the services that clients are looking for are usually more nuanced and need additional clarification. After we've discussed your needs and the ideas you've brought to the table, I'll generally provide you with sketches- few different variations of the ideas we've talked about. From there, you can decide which direction you'd like to go in and I'll develop that sketch, usually with 2 or 3 rounds of edits (I send you the proof, you make comments, I'll send you an updated proof). Once the final proof has been approved, you will receive a print quality pdf, EPS or web ready images (depending on what kind of project we're working on).
